Being able to use string formatting without a heap is pretty cool. Rusts string formatting machinery does not require any heap allocations at all, you can for example impl fmt::Write for a struct that writes directly to a serial console byte-by-byte with no allocations, and then you have access to all of rusts string formatting features available to print over a serial console!
